
Singer Younha is releasing her first remake album, "SUB CHARACTER," 22 years after her debut. On February 2nd at 6 PM, Younha will release the pre-release single from this album on various online music platforms.
On the 9th, Younha revealed a teaser image announcing the pre-release track of "SUB CHARACTER" on her official SNS. In the image, Younha shows a sad expression with tears in her eyes, conveying deep emotion. Her delicate emotional expression and wistful facial acting leave a poignant impression on viewers.
"SUB CHARACTER" is Younha's first remake album. Before the official album release, she plans to pre-release some tracks to showcase her uniquely compelling vocals and her own profound reinterpretations.
From January 9th to February 1st, Younha is holding a small theater concert titled "Shining Winter" for a total of 12 days at Samsung Hall, Ewha Womans University, Seodaemun-gu, Seoul. The first performance on the 9th was a great success, and during the concert period, she surprised fans by announcing the release of the remake album.
The name of the pre-release single and detailed album information will be revealed sequentially through teasers.
Meanwhile, Younha is currently active as the sole host of the web variety show "Wooju Record." Recently, she donated 100 million KRW to the Korea Student Aid Foundation to establish the "Blue Lighthouse Singer Younha Scholarship" in 2026. This scholarship aims to provide continuous support and sharing for talents in the basic science field.
